WebbThe sludge-clay mixture was rolled into round balls of approximate 15 mm diameters. The balls were then baked in an incineration oven for 1.5 h at 600oC, cooled down completely and used in the experimental procedures. 2.2 Experimental design A 2-liter laboratory-scale bio-filter was set up and packed tightly with the manufactured sludge-clay balls.

The problem was partially addressed a few days back when … Webb14 feb. 2024 · On ultrasound, sludge most commonly forms a fluid-fluid level. The sludge is seen at the bottom of the gallbladder forming a sharp interface with the normal bile …

Webb22 aug. 2024 · A cholecystectomy, surgical removal of the gallbladder, is the most common treatment for gallstones that are causing symptoms. Other non-surgical procedures to remove gallstones include percutaneous removal, ESWL, and ERCP.
